This project document proposes the establishment and piloting of a blended, non-accredited, vocational and practical training programme concentrated around the fundamentals of exporting and the opportunities resulting from the AfCFTA. This curriculum will be developed by the SME Trade Academy in collaboration with the Afreximbank.

Local partners, such as trade training institutions will provide support in implementation of the pilot programme in three countries, namely Nigeria, Rwanda and Côte d'Ivoire.

The pilot will involve building local partners’ capacity to market the training and conduct sessions on a continuous basis, localizing the offering for each national context.

An expansion phase has been added to the project involving a further 12 countries. The online training will be opened to all African countries.

Le travail de l'ITC dans les régions du Moyen-Orient et de l'Afrique du Nord consiste notamment à encourager les exportations de textiles et de vêtements afin de promouvoir l'emploi et la génération de revenus tout au long de la chaîne de valeur. Dans ce cadre, les efforts de l’ITC se concentrent sur les infrastructures et politiques institutionnelles, la diversification des produits, le passage au numérique et au commerce électronique, la durabilité à la fois sociale et environnementale, et l'inclusion des femmes.
